Unbound. Publisher's blues, unbound gatherings laid into glossy wrappers. Small octavo. Fine. Cover reproduces a painting by Glenn Harrington; neither the design nor the painting were used in the published edition. Winner of the 1934 Newbery Medal. Publisher's blues were printed in very small numbers.
